Добавлю.
Btrfs не поддерживает файлы подкачки. Несоблюдение этого предупреждения, может стать результатом разрушения файловой системы. Пока что, файл подкачки может быть использован в Btrfs, если смонтирован через loop-устройство, тогда будет сильно уменьшена производительность подкачки.
Мораль: используйте swap-раздел либо FS, которые не разваливаются в процессе свопинга.
UUID — UUID вашего раздела с корнем системы (тут лежит swapfile).
resume_offset — физическое расположение файла свап, подсмотрите в АрчВики как это значение найти.
мне кажется не в нехватке памяти дело. У меня тоже 16гб, вкладок по 30 открываю. Специально тестировал с открытым монитором, памяти хватает с головой.
Свап в файл парой команд делается, если что… wiki.archlinux.org/title/Swap
В современном linux особого значения не имеет, раздел вы сделаете или файл подкачки. Если не хотите переразмечать диск, сделайте файл подкачки. Но, что раздел, что файл должны находиться на том же ssd, что и система, чтобы не терять в скорости. 16 Гб должно хватить для гибернации
Подскажите пожалуйста, правильно ли я понимаю, что в данном случае не имеет смысла использовать Zswap, а нужен именно обычный Swap? И что лучше сделать файл подкачки на 32 GB, а не раздел подкачки, чтобы не переделывать разделы. (Планирую также регулярно использовать режим гибернации)
Как только запускаю ОС занято около 2ГБ. Начинаю запускать вкладки браузеров, IDE и прочее — может дойти до 8. Проблема ещё и в том, что непонятно в какой момент и от чего это происходит. Иногда целый день подряд нагружаю и не зависает, а иногда через час после запуска ОС. Сегодня вообще зависло когда было открыто только штук 10 вкладок chrome, несколько в firefox, консоль. Может где-то утечка, или что-то из железа шалит. (но на винде на том же ноуте нет проблем)
Видимо буду делать swap как руки дойдут.
да он, но если совсем глухо так тормозит с самого начала, то, наверно все же не он. Если свап не делали, то может и правда нужен, хотя 16Гб оперативки должно хватать. Посмотрите сколько расходуется оперативы. Ну, и если реально подбирается к лимиту, то сделайте свап в файл.
У меня на KDE похожим образом подвешивал систему процесс Baloo. Попробуйте его отключить на денек-другой и понаблюдать, будут ли фризы такие продолжаться. Ну или как только начинает лагать, то вызвать монитор процессов и посмотреть кто сжирает все ресурсы.
Btrfs не поддерживает файлы подкачки. Несоблюдение этого предупреждения, может стать результатом разрушения файловой системы. Пока что, файл подкачки может быть использован в Btrfs, если смонтирован через loop-устройство, тогда будет сильно уменьшена производительность подкачки.
Мораль: используйте swap-раздел либо FS, которые не разваливаются в процессе свопинга.
В /etc/default/grub в GRUB_CMDLINE_LINUX_DEFAULT вписать после quiet что-то вроде
UUID — UUID вашего раздела с корнем системы (тут лежит swapfile).
resume_offset — физическое расположение файла свап, подсмотрите в АрчВики как это значение найти.
Ну и пересобрать Grub, запускаем с sudo
И на всякий случай, как сделать swapfile
linux-firmware-qlogic
wd719x-firmware
upd72020x-fw
aic94xx-firmware
затем:
sudo mkinitcpio -P
+ как написали отредактировать /etc/vconsole.conf добавив FONT=cyr-sun16
можно забиндить 2 шортката на клавиши, если эти 2 команды работают, и не надо будет лезть в терминал.
Свап в файл парой команд делается, если что…
wiki.archlinux.org/title/Swap
Почитайте там, особенно в конце топика. Мне помогло во всех дистрах, в т.ч. и на Манджаро.
Видимо буду делать swap как руки дойдут.
Проблема в том, что как только начинаются подтормаживания уже не работает ни вызов монитора процессов (ctrl+Esc), ни даже переключение в консоль.